Lets compare vitamin content per 100 calories of Baked Red Potatoes vs Zucchini Summer Squash with Skin:
100 kcal of Raw Zucchini Summer Squash with Skin contain 51.2 times more Vitamin A, 3.2 times more Vitamin B1, 9.6 times more Vitamin B2, 1.4 times more Vitamin B3, 3.1 times more Vitamin B5, 3.9 times more Vitamin B6, 4.5 times more Vitamin B9, 7.3 times more Vitamin C, 7.7 times more Vitamin E and 7.9 times more Vitamin K than Baked Whole Red Potatoes.
100 calories of Baked Red Potatoes have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A and Vitamin E
Both Baked Whole Red Potatoes as well as Raw Zucchini Summer Squash with Skin have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B12 and Vitamin D in 100 calories.
Comparing minerals per 100 calories for Baked Red Potatoes vs Zucchini Summer Squash with Skin:
100 kcal of Raw Zucchini Summer Squash with Skin contain 9.1 times more Calcium, 1.6 times more Copper, 2.7 times more Iron, 3.3 times more Magnesium, 5.2 times more Manganese, 2.7 times more Phosphorus, 2.5 times more Potassium, 3.4 times more Sodium, 4.1 times more Zinc and 6.3 times more Water than Baked Whole Red Potatoes.
100 calories of Baked Red Potatoes lack sufficient amounts of Calcium
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 100 calories:
100 calories of Baked Red Potatoes have 1.2 times more Carbohydrate than Zucchini Summer Squash with Skin.
While 100 kcal of Raw Zucchini Summer Squash with Skin contain 20.8 times more Omega 3, 8.9 times more Sugars, 16.1 times more Fructose, 2.8 times more Fiber and 2.7 times more Protein than Baked Whole Red Potatoes.
